TOWN/SUBURB FACILITIES
Ascot is a well established suburb in the City of Brisbane, Queensland, characterised by large Queenslander homes. Ascot is located approximately 7 kilometres (4 mi) north-east of Brisbane's Central Business District. Ascot is perhaps locally best known for its beautiful old homes, the picturesque poinciana tree lined shopping area of Racecourse Road, and for the Eagle Farm and Doomben racecourses popular for racing carnivals. Over a third of the suburb is taken up by Doomben and its related outer buildings, Eagle Farm and Doomben racecourses.
Ascot is generally an affluent area – many new apartment buildings being developed and built over last few years.
TOURIST INFORMATION
Ascot is famous in the horse racing industry for its Doomben racecourse, the location of many high profile group races throughout the National horse racing calender.
